I’m using the new dimension component to dimension my street network or rooms in buildings and I also frequently use Text Dots to display information that I have to read from my script. However, as the file gets heavier, the custom preview component starts to bog down on the dimensions and larger sets of data, unlike the annotation components. Would it be possible to expose a preview color setting for the annotation components directly? It might be quicker/ easier to use/reuse @AndyPayne?
This may not be ideal, but you could try to assign the color using the Object Display/Model Object components and then bake the annotations to your document. If you set the Content Cache to “push” automatically, then it should update pretty quickly (perhaps quicker than the Custom Preview component).
We do eventually want to add a new Preview component which would work with Model Objects. Essentially this type of preview component would display an object using all of its effective attributes (ie. display color, linetype, etc.) This is on our road map but I don’t have a timeline as to when that would be available.
